Job description

Variety Child Learning Center (VCLC) is a 4410 not-for-profit agency providing quality educational and therapeutic services to young children with disabilities. We are actively recruiting candidates for the Education Coordinator position.

Essential Functions
  • Provide instructional leadership, supervision, and ongoing support to teachers, teaching assistants, and teacher aides.
  • Oversee classroom programming to ensure instruction is individualized, developmentally appropriate, and aligned with student IEP goals.
  • Lead and support the implementation of curriculum, classroom management systems, instructional practices, and positive behavior supports.
  • Ensure classroom practices are consistent with NYS Prekindergarten Learning Standards, Early Learning Guidelines, and the Pyramid Model. Knowledge of the STAR Program curriculum is preferred.
  • Promote safe, structured, and therapeutic classroom environments that support student learning, engagement, and regulation.
  • Collaborate with school leadership, related service providers, and classroom teams to ensure consistent, high-quality educational programming.
  • Conduct classroom observations, provide staff coaching, and support professional growth and problem‑solving.
  • Help ensure compliance with agency, state, and regulatory requirements related to classroom instruction and educational programming.
  • Provide classroom and building support as assigned, including transitions, staffing coverage, lunch and bus duty.
Requirements
  • School Building Leader (SBL) certification required; & master’s degree in special education (preferred)
  • NYS Students with Disabilities – Birth–Grade 2, All Grades, or NYS Special Education Certification
  • Minimum of 3 years of Special Education classroom experience
  • Strong leadership, communication, and staff support skills
  • Experience working with preschool students with disabilities preferred
Salary & Benefits

School Breaks (up to 7 weeks), Health Insurance, Dental Insurance, New York Sick Leave, Disability Insurance, Flexible Spending Account, 403(b) Retirement Account, 401(a) Pension Contribution, Life Insurance, Vision Insurance.

Work Environment

This job operates in a school environment. Activities usually take place in classrooms, hallways, the gym, outside on the playground, or in special activity rooms. This role routinely uses standard office equipment such as laptop computers, iPads, printers/fax/scanner, telephone, and shredder.

Physical Demands

This role may be physically demanding. The employee is required to be non-sedentary. Must be able to stand, walk, sit, bend, climb stairs, balance, stoop, kneel, crouch, and move throughout the school environment. The employee may need to lift and/or assist an average preschool-aged child (35 pounds) and school-age child (50 pounds), as needed.
